2. Taxes, Fees, and the Hidden Costs
Once youโve settled on the base model, the fun (and by fun, we mean the financial commitment) really starts. There are several additional costs to consider:
- Sales Tax: Depending on your state, sales tax can add another 5% to 10% to the final price. So, if youโre in a high-tax state, that $70,000 A6L could easily bump up to $77,000.
- Documentation Fees: These are typically around $200 to $400, but can vary widely depending on the dealer.
- Destination Charges: These are the costs associated with delivering the car from the factory to the dealership, usually ranging from $1,000 to $1,500.
- Registration and Title Fees: These can range from $200 to $500, again depending on your state.

4. Maintenance and Insurance: The Long-Term Costs
Now, letโs talk about the ongoing costs. Luxury cars like the A6L require regular maintenance, which can be pricey due to the specialized parts and labor. Additionally, insurance premiums for luxury vehicles tend to be higher, as do registration fees. Over the course of several years, these costs can easily add up to tens of thousands of dollars. ๐
